White, not Hispanic health insurance coverage rates in Lauderdale County, Mississippi compared

How does Lauderdale County, Mississippi compare to other Mississippi and National averages?

  • Lauderdale County, Mississippi

    92.8%

  • Mississippi

    91.7% (-1% lower than Lauderdale County, Mississippi)

  • National average

    94.9% (2% higher than Lauderdale County, Mississippi)
